10th ranked Indianapolis rallies past Panthers in doubleheader

SPRINGFIELD, Mo.— 10th ranked Indianapolis pulled away from Drury to win game one 10-1, then rallied with four runs in the sixth to take game two in a doubleheader sweep of the Panthers on Sunday at Thompson Field in Springfield.
 
Indianapolis ran their winning streak to 16 games and improved to 25-2 and 4-0 in the Great Lakes Valley Conference. Drury fell to 12-17 and 0-4 in the GLVC.
 
The Greyhounds took command of game one with five runs in the third inning, scoring on three RBI singles, a bases-loaded hit batter, and a sacrifice fly.
 
Drury’s lone run came in the fifth, when Brooklyn LaChoppa hit a one-out triple, then scored on a single by Taylor Hartsell.
 
Indianapolis added a run in the sixth, and three in the seventh. Greyhounds starter Kenzie Smith improved to 12-0 with the win, while Kristina Bettis (2-6) took the loss. Hartsell finished the game going 2 for 4 with a double and Drury’s lone RBI.
 
Game two was scoreless until the fifth when the Panthers struck for a pair of runs. Sophie Luetticke and Lauren Beier drove in runs with RBI singles off of UIndy pitcher Kenzie Smith, who came out of the bullpen in the fifth.
 
The Greyhounds took advantage of two Drury errors in the sixth and posted four runs in the frame. UIndy pulled even on a wild pitch, then a Shelby Cook two-RBI double gave her team a 4-2 lead.
 
Panthers starter Kaley Adzick got stuck with a no-decision after going five innings, allowing one hit with three walks and two strikeouts. Bailee Nixon (6-2) took the loss in relief for Drury despite not allowing an earned run, while Smith got her second win of the day as she went to 13-0.
 
Lauren Beier was 2 for 3 at the plate for Drury with a double and an RBI, while Hartsell was 2 for 4 with a double and a run.
 
The Panthers are on the road for their next doubleheader as they travel to Maryville on Saturday.
